Correction of rotational deformities in long bones using guided growth: a scoping review.

Abstract

PURPOSE

The objective of this scoping review was to describe the extent and type of evidence of using guided growth to correct rotational deformities of long bones in children.

METHODS

This scoping review was conducted in accordance with the JBI methodology for scoping reviews. All published and unpublished studies investigating surgical methods using guided growth to perform gradual rotation of long bones were included.

RESULTS

Fourteen studies were included: one review, three clinical studies, and ten preclinical studies. In the three clinical studies, three different surgical methods were used on 21 children. Some degree of rotation was achieved in all but two children. Adverse effects reported included limb length discrepancy (LLD), knee stiffness and rebound of rotation after removal of tethers. Of the ten preclinical studies, two were ex vivo and eight were in vivo. Rotation was achieved in all preclinical studies. Adverse effects reported included implant extrusions, LLD, articular deformities, joint stiffness and rebound of rotation after removal of tethers. Two of the studies reported on histological changes.

CONCLUSIONS

All studies conclude that guided growth is a potential treatment for rotational deformities of long bones. There is great variation in animal models and surgical methods used and in reported adverse effects. More research is needed to shed light on the best surgical guided growth method, its effectiveness as well as the involved risks and complications. Based on current evidence the procedure is still to be considered experimental.

摘要

目的

本综述的目的是描述使用引导性生长矫正儿童长骨旋转畸形的证据范围和类型。

方法

本综述按照JBI循证综述方法开展。纳入所有已发表和未发表的研究,这些研究调查了使用引导性生长进行长骨逐渐旋转的手术方法。

结果

共纳入14项研究:1篇综述、3项临床研究和10项临床前研究。在3项临床研究中,对21名儿童使用了3种不同的手术方法。除2名儿童外,其余儿童均实现了一定程度的旋转。报告的不良反应包括肢体长度差异(LLD)、膝关节僵硬以及去除牵引线后旋转反弹。在10项临床前研究中,2项为体外研究,8项为体内研究。所有临床前研究均实现了旋转。报告的不良反应包括植入物挤出、LLD、关节畸形、关节僵硬以及去除牵引线后旋转反弹。其中2项研究报告了组织学变化。

结论

所有研究均得出结论,引导性生长是长骨旋转畸形的一种潜在治疗方法。所使用的动物模型、手术方法以及报告的不良反应存在很大差异。需要更多研究来阐明最佳的手术引导性生长方法、其有效性以及相关风险和并发症。基于目前的证据,该手术仍应被视为实验性手术。
